We may receive your personal data after voluntary provision through: Sending an inquiry to create an offer, through the order form on the website; Sending an electronic message, through the contact form on the website; Types of personal data collected We (Administrator) collect, process and store the following types of personal data: Contact data (names, phone, email); Company data (name, EIK/BULSTAT, management address); Financial data (payment data and/or tax invoice issuance); Marketing data (your preferences for receiving marketing messages); Visits (we track your interests to establish your preferences); IP address; Cookies Essence: Cookies are files with information containing unlimited text content that are stored on users' computers to improve work with the respective website. These files allow the user to be recognized and the website to be adapted to their preferences. Cookies usually contain the name of the website to which they belong, the time for which they are stored on the user's computer and a unique number. Purposes: Cookies are used to adapt website content to individual user preferences and optimize work with the specific website. They are also used to generate anonymous general statistics that help us understand how the user works with websites, which helps improve their structure and content, while at the same time there is no access to personal information. Personal data content: Personal information accumulated through cookies can only be used to perform certain operations for the user. Such information is encrypted in a way that makes access by unauthorized persons impossible. Deletion: By default, applications used for web browsing allow saving cookies. This setting can be changed so that automatic saving of cookies is blocked in the web browser or the user is informed each time before cookies are saved on the computer. Detailed information about different ways of working with cookies can be found in the web browser settings. Limiting cookies may affect some website functionalities.
